Babe Birrer Babe Birrer
Full name: Werner Joseph Birrer
Born: July 4, 1928, Buffalo, New York
First Game: June 5, 1955; Final Game: September 24, 1958
Bat: Right Throw: Right Height: 6' 0" Weight: 195

TransactionsTransactions
Signed as an amateur free agent by Detroit Tigers (1947).

Claimed on waivers by Baltimore Orioles from Detroit Tigers (April 5, 1956).

Sold by Baltimore Orioles to Brooklyn Dodgers (June 15, 1957).
